18 inch Tires is all I run on my Raptor for drags; if you gear it correctly for 18's they are hard to beat. You also shed quite a few pounds of rotating mass off the drive axle by using 18's which is always good. We have tried stock 20 inch Raptor tires,20 inch Ohtsu mr501's, 22 inch pro wedges, and 18 inch knotched Turf Tamers all geared accordingly and the 18's performed the best in soft or hard pack drag track conditions for us. I am now running 18 inch MXR Holeshots with screws and they seem to be even better than the Tamers so far. Get some 18's; Gear accordingly with some 18's and I think you'll be suprised at the difference. Slim
